Carrington Academy in Cumming Donates Nearly 600 Food Items

Carrington Academy students held a food drive and several gift drives to give back during the holidays

Students at Carrington Academy on Majors Road in Cumming held several giving initiatives for the holiday season. During the school’s food drive to help stock the shelves of the Georgia Mountain Food Bank, they collected and donated nearly 600 nonperishable food items to feed local families.

Students also held a gift drive and collected more than 40 gifts benefitting the Make-A-Wish® Foundation, as well as children who are residing at Ronald McDonald House chapters in Georgia while undergoing treatment. Pre-K 2 students presented some of the gifts they collected to a representative from Ronald McDonald House. Through their efforts, students learned the importance of helping others, especially during the holiday season.
